Q: Is 3,792,694 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,792,694 is a composite number.

Why is 3,792,694 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,792,694 can be evenly divided by 1 2 1,229 1,543 2,458 3,086 1,896,347 and 3,792,694, with no remainder.

Since 3,792,694 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,792,694, it is a composite number.
